logo

Zmienna globalna JavaScript

A Zmienna globalna JavaScript jest zadeklarowany poza funkcją lub zadeklarowany z obiektem okna. Dostęp do niego można uzyskać z dowolnej funkcji.

Zobaczmy prosty przykład zmiennej globalnej w JavaScript.

 var value=50;//global variable function a(){ alert(value); } function b(){ alert(value); } 
Przetestuj teraz

Deklarowanie zmiennej globalnej JavaScript w funkcji

Aby zadeklarować zmienne globalne JavaScript wewnątrz funkcji, musisz użyć obiekt okna . Na przykład:

 window.value=90; 

Teraz można go zadeklarować wewnątrz dowolnej funkcji i można uzyskać do niego dostęp z dowolnej funkcji. Na przykład:

 function m(){ window.value=100;//declaring global variable by window object } function n(){ alert(window.value);//accessing global variable from other function } 
Przetestuj teraz

Elementy wewnętrzne zmiennej globalnej w JavaScript

Kiedy deklarujesz zmienną poza funkcją, jest ona wewnętrznie dodawana do obiektu okna. Dostęp do niego można uzyskać również poprzez obiekt okna. Na przykład:

 var value=50; function a(){ alert(window.value);//accessing global variable }